For the adult workshop, Carlos presents the challenges faced by parents, schools, communities and law enforcement who deal with juvenile gangs and drug dealers.   Participants will explore the identification and profile of a gang member, as well as why teens join them.   Carlos discusses the historical backgrounds of how gangs started in the United States: why, the origins and/or culture of the different types of gangs, and their spread through the United States.

WORKSHOP OVERVIEW on Gangs (and why teens think they’re cool)

  1.  Historical background of how gangs started in the U. S. 
  2. The why and how of white hate supremacist gangs and how they effectively recruit through the media.
  3. Background of Black or Afro American American Gangs and their transformation from Black Panthers to Vice Lords to Crips, Bloods and Guerilla Family
  4. History of Hispanic Gangs which include the Mara Salvatrucha, Mexican Mafia, Nuestra Familia (Nortenos/Surenos), Latin Kings, Zetas, Netas, etc. The Mindset of hispanic gangbangers (as with others) who see themselves as soldiers or protectors of their “hood”.
  5. Asian gangs including Triads and Tongs. The Asian community is an extremely closed mouth community and even more so about its criminal element.
  6. Gang member characteristics may be defined into 3 categories: Hardcore, Associates and Peripheral members.

The adult workshops focus on substance abuse and the power of the financial incentive in the drug world.   Drug and gang marketing are discussed as is the power of the media, graffiti, weapons, and different types paraphernalia, explosives and their easy access to youth.  

The adult workshops may be presented in 2-8 hours, depending on the amount and detail of material you want presented.   The workshop may emphasize a particular area based on the audience.   The objective of the training is to provide participants an awareness of the illegal drug and criminal gangs.   Carlos brings with him a number of trunks full of paraphernalia.
